NMEA Checksums

I have wrapped a project up, and thought I would share a piece of it for everyone to use.

This is for dealing with the hex checksum in GPS messages. It will allow you to validate the string, as well as generate a checksum if you are outputing messages as well.

Code:

/*
          file: nmea_chk.c
       project: open functions
   description: NMEA checksum validate and generate
      compiler: CCS C
   written by : Michael Bradley


  2 Functions:
  ------------------------------------------------------
  nmea_validateChecksum(char *strPtr);
    pass a string to validate data against checksum
    returns either TRUE (1) or FALSE (0)

  nmea_generateChecksum(char *strPtr);
    pass a complete user generated string that does not contain '*xx'
    returns binary byte that is the checksum, you must convert to hex.

   simple way to print it out:
   int8 chk;
   chk = nmea_generateChecksum(origString);
   printf("%s*%2X\r\n",origString,chk);

*/



// this takes a nmea gps string, and validates it againts the checksum
// at the end if the string. (requires first byte to be $)
int8 nmea_validateChecksum(char *strPtr)
{
   int p;
   char c;
   unsigned int8 chksum;
   unsigned int8 nmeaChk;
   int8 flagValid;
   char hx[5] = "0x00";

   flagValid = TRUE; // we start true, and make it false if things are not right

   if (strPtr[0] != '$' ) { flagValid = FALSE; }

   // if we are still good, test all bytes
   if (flagValid == TRUE)
     {
     c = strPtr[1]; // get first chr
     chksum = c;
     p = 2;
     while ( ( c != '*' ) && ( p < SERIAL_STR_SIZE ) )
       {
       c = strPtr[p]; // get next chr
       if ( c != '*' ) { chksum = chksum ^ c; }
       p++;
       }
     // at this point we are either at * or at end of string
     hx[2] = strPtr[p];
     hx[3] = strPtr[p+1];
     hx[4] = 0x00;
     nmeaChk = atoi(hx);
     if ( chksum != nmeaChk ) { flagValid = FALSE; }
     }

   return flagValid;
}


// this returns a single binary byte that is the checksum
// you must convert it to hex if you are going to print it or send it
unsigned int8 nmea_generateChecksum(char *strPtr)
{
   int p;
   char c;
   unsigned int8 chksum;

   c = strPtr[0]; // get first chr
   chksum = c;
   p = 1;
   while ( c != 0x00 )
     {
     c = strPtr[p]; // get next chr
     if ( c != 0x00 ) { chksum = chksum ^ c; }
     p++;
     }

   return chksum;
}
